Tokyo: A City of Neon and Zen
As Japan's capital and most populous city, Tokyo is a vibrant hub of culture, entertainment, and technology. Explore the iconic Shibuya Crossing, where throngs of pedestrians create a kaleidoscope of movimiento and energy. Immerse yourself in the neon-lit streets of Akihabara, known as the "Electric Town" for its abundance of electronics stores. Or escape the urban hustle and bustle in tranquil gardens like the Hama-rikyu Onshi Teien, where you can admire cherry blossoms in spring or relax by the waterfront.
Kyoto: A Timeless Tapestry of History and Tradition
Once Japan's imperial capital, Kyoto is a city steeped in history and tradition. Wander through the picturesque streets of Gion, Kyoto's geisha district, and admire the beauty of traditional wooden buildings. Visit the iconic Fushimi Inari Shrine, renowned for its thousands of vermilion torii gates that lead up the mountainside. Or participate in a traditional tea ceremony to experience the essence of Japanese hospitality and mindfulness.
Osaka: Japan's Kitchen and Culinary Capital
Known as Japan's "kitchen," Osaka is a culinary paradise where food lovers can indulge in a plethora of gastronomic delights. Explore the vibrant Dotonbori district, famous for its street food stalls and lively atmosphere. Dive into the flavors of Takoyaki, octopus-filled batter balls, or savor the melt-in-your-mouth wagyu beef at a local restaurant. Osaka also boasts a thriving arts and entertainment scene, with theaters and museums offering a diverse range of cultural experiences.
Hakone: A Natural Oasis of Onsen and Scenic Beauty
Nestled amidst the lush foothills of Mount Fuji, Hakone is a picturesque retreat known for its natural hot springs and breathtaking scenery. Relax in an onsen, a traditional Japanese bath, and soak in the rejuvenating waters while admiring the surrounding mountains. Take a boat ride on Lake Ashi and marvel at the iconic silhouette of Mount Fuji on a clear day. Or hike through the Hakone Open-Air Museum, where art harmoniously blends with nature.
Okinawa: A Tropical Paradise of Beaches and Coral Reefs
Located in the southernmost part of Japan, Okinawa is a subtropical archipelago renowned for its pristine beaches and vibrant coral reefs. Dive into the turquoise waters of Ishigaki or Miyako Islands and encounter a kaleidoscope of marine life. Snorkel or scuba dive through the vibrant coral reefs and marvel at the diversity of colorful fish and sea creatures. Okinawa also boasts a rich history and culture, with ancient castles and traditional villages that offer a glimpse into the past.
Sapporo: A Winter Wonderland and Culinary Hub
Known as the "City of Snow," Sapporo offers a unique winter experience. Witness the awe-inspiring Sapporo Snow Festival, where gigantic snow and ice sculptures transform the city into a winter wonderland. Visit the Sapporo Beer Museum to learn about the history and brewing process of Japan's most famous beer. Or indulge in the local culinary delights, such as miso ramen, soup curry, and fresh seafood.
Hiroshima: A Legacy of Peace and Remembrance
Hiroshima is a city forever etched in history as the site of the first atomic bombing in 1945. Visit the Hiroshima Peace Memorial Park and the Hiroshima Peace Memorial Museum to learn about the devastating impact of the atomic bomb and its legacy of peace and nuclear disarmament. The park is a serene and contemplative space where visitors can pay their respects and reflect on the horrors of war.
